Output 666eac80d0b462660c74e6525a9b67bd44f7b2a8f63a1d0bfacc284363c5613d:4

value
857837
script pubkey
OP_0 OP_PUSHBYTES_20 e1b1b214e473d6431baae870540c39b92ebeef9a
address
bc1quxcmy98yw0tyxxa2apc9grpehyhtamu6tktjk2
transaction
666eac80d0b462660c74e6525a9b67bd44f7b2a8f63a1d0bfacc284363c5613d
spent
true